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3856467 178379 83387524 85429 43
6726058204 404178520
6726058204 404178520
1040 733591 507325
All about undefined
Interested in learning more?
6726058204 404178520
1040 733591 507325
See more
853971 48 22821990
30096 562 2478769
See more
729469706 27164856 17392
14763798 490237827 527900 682807237 49309
See more